While I came in only with the SC2 scene, I think I've got the idea of what KeSPA is up to.

For an American audience, they seem to be headed into a MLS-like system. In that system, KeSPA would actually "own" the teams. The teams wouldn't be run by KeSPA though. They'd have a team principal that makes those choices. They'd be doing this mostly so the title sponsors don't have to foot all of the bill for the costs. This also allows them to bring in more sponsors at a lower cost.

The general idea is, just throwing out hypothetical numbers, that a team costs say 3 million USD a year. But the companies don't feel like they get that return anymore on that much money. But they might feel they'd be fine at 1.5 million USD per year. There is a problem, however, as team sponsorship is an "either/or" decision. With KeSPA actually owning the teams, they sponsors can buy in, for possibly multiple teams, at a lower cost. Say Korean Air wants to sponsor 4 teams @ 500 thousand USD a year? Now they could, and they'd have their logos show up in roughly 50% of all matches.

That would make a lot of sense, but we're working with a double translated speculation. So, take it as that until we have more information.
